Mainly dry today in Donegal for Bank Holiday Monday with a good deal of cloud, though there will be a few sunny breaks.
Some patchy light rain and drizzle will also occur. Highest temperatures of 10 to 13 degrees with moderate to fresh south to southeast winds.
Tonight will be dry with long clear spells in the east. It will be cloudier further west with the odd spot of rain or drizzle. Lowest temperatures of 5 to 8 degrees with moderate, occasionally fresh, southeast winds.
Tomorrow will start mostly dry with sunny spells in the east. Cloudier conditions in the west will spread eastwards with showery outbreaks of rain continuing, mainly in western areas and turning heavy and possibly thundery at times, before easing through the evening.
Mild with highest temperatures of 13 to 16 degrees in moderate, occasionally fresh, southeast winds, easing mostly light later.
